INTRODUCTION
Several methods exist for yeast transformation. This protocol describes high-efficiency transformation and was adapted from Gietz and Schiestl (1995). A simpler, though less efficient, transformation protocol can be found in "Quick and Dirty" Plasmid Transformation of Yeast Colonies.
MATERIALS
Reagents
Appropriate plates containing selective media
High-molecular-weight DNA (deoxyribonucleic acid sodium salt type III from salmon testes; Sigma)
Lithium acetate, 1 M and 100 mM
Plasmid DNA for transformation
Polyethylene glycol (PEG) 3350 (Sigma), 50% (w/v)
TE buffer (pH 8.0)
Yeast strain to be transformed
YPAD, liquid or synthetic complete (SC) medium
